Unit Secretary – Paed.Out-Patient Clinic, FT (J0925-0821)
North York General Hospital is inviting applications for a full‑time Unit Secretary. The role provides administrative, secretarial, and receptionist support for the Paediatric Unit and Paediatric Outpatient Clinic.
Position Summary
The successful candidate will perform confidential and professional administrative duties in a fast‑paced and stressful environment, supporting hospital care, teaching, learning, and research activities.
Responsibilities
- Support and adhere to hospital policies and procedures.
- Communicate effectively with staff, patients, families, and internal and external parties.
- Coordinate interdepartmental activities, schedule appointments, and manage discharge and other unit services.
- Accept, triage, and process telephone calls and inquiries in a timely manner.
- Compile and disseminate program activity documents.
- Manage confidential information with professionalism.
- Maintain attendance / time‑reporting information and arrange relief as required.
- Process computer provider order entries and notify staff and appropriate departments.
- Support clinicians with system order entry, patient appointments, and follow‑ups.
- Process requisitions for laboratory and imaging studies, ensuring documentation and follow‑up.
- Maintain organization of admissions, discharges, outstanding orders, medication information, and unit supplies.
- Prepare statistics, reports, and discharge instructions.
- Apply patient‑centered communication with patients, families, staff, physicians, and volunteers.
